Fluke 5960A Triple Point of Argon System

Manufacturer: Fluke Calibration
Model: 5960A
Features
- Low uncertainty of 0.25 mK
- Temperature plateau duration longer than 30 hours
- Four entrant wells with radial uniformity less than 0.05 mK
- 480 mm total immersion depth
- Argon purity of 99.9999 %

Specifications
| Specification | Details |
|---|---|
| Assigned value | -189.3442 °C |
| Argon gas purity | 99.9999 % (6N purity) |
| Uncertainty (k=2) | 0.25 mK |
| Length of plateau (0.1 mK) | >30 hours |
| Argon cell depth* | 160 mm |
| Number of entrant wells | 4 |
| Radial uniformity | 0.05 mK |
| Total immersion depth | 480 mm |
| Entrant well inner diameter (ID) | 8.0 mm |
| Argon gas volume | 13.4 moles (535 grams) |
| Liquid nitrogen Dewar volume | 44.2 liters |
| Display resolution | 0.001 °C |
| Set-point accuracy | 0.1 °C (adjustable) |
| Power requirements | 100 V to 115 V (± 10 %) 50/60 Hz, 230 W 230 V (± 10 %) 50/60 Hz, 230 W |
| System fuse ratings | 115 V: 2 A T 250 V 230 V: 1 A T 250 V |
| Size (HxWxD) | 952 mm x 673 mm x 483 mm (37.5 in x 26.5 in x 19 in) |
| Weight | 94 kg (207 lbs) |
| *Measured from the bottom of the probe well to the surface of the argon sample | |
